ADHD Assessment - Why it's Important to Get a Private ADHD Diagnosis
Getting an ADHD assessment is crucial for anyone who believes they may be suffering from undiagnosed ADHD. The process can require up to two sessions. It is recommended to bring a friend or family member. The evaluation will also include a discussion of the history of mental health and family history.
Right to Choose allows you to request your GP to perform an ADHD assessment if you reside in England. Psychiatry UK offers helpful details on how to accomplish this including samples of letters and forms for your GP.
Costs
It is important to know the cost of an adult ADHD evaluation before you commit to a treatment plan. If you're in desperate need of an ADHD diagnosis, the costs could be worth it. Many people find an ADHD diagnosis to be life-changing. It can help them focus as well as their work and family lives, and may even lead them to better mental health.
In addition to the costs in addition, you'll also need to pay for any prescriptions given by your Psychiatrist. These prescriptions are not covered by the NHS and you'll need to pay for them yourself. In some instances, you might be required to attend follow-ups to keep track of your medication. These follow-ups typically occur every three to four weeks until the dosage is stable.
Ask your GP to sign a shared-care arrangement with the private Psychiatrist. This will stop you from receiving a diagnosis privately, and then going to the NHS where your GP may not be supportive of your medication plan. This can be a problem because some doctors refuse to sign the agreement.
A certified healthcare professional should conduct a thorough interview and background check before diagnosing ADHD in adults. This is a complex and arduous process, therefore it shouldn't be taken lightly. NICE guidelines say that a psychiatrist registered in the UK or a specialist ADHD Nurse is able to conduct an evaluation of psychiatric disorders for ADHD.
The NHS is currently experiencing a shortage of fully-trained ADHD assessors, meaning that waiting times can be long. However, if you're registered with a GP in England, you have the option of choosing your own ADHD assessor. This is known as the 'Right to Choose' pathway. These independent providers have shorter waiting times than the NHS. Moreover, some of them offer appointments online via video call. This makes it easier for those with mobility issues or other factors to get an ADHD assessment.
Making an answer to a question
A diagnosis of ADHD is a challenging, emotional process. It can take years before some individuals are able to receive an assessment through the NHS. There are ways to speed this process by going private. The NHS offers a 'Right to Choose" pathway which allows patients to choose their own mental health care provider. This is a faster way to get an ADHD assessment. It is important to talk with your GP about your concerns if considering a private diagnosis. It may also be beneficial to write down the reasons why you think that you may have ADHD. This will allow your GP to understand why you are seeking an assessment.
The NHS is currently facing an acute shortage of psychiatrists capable of testing adults for ADHD. This is due to the increased demand for services, as well as an insufficient funding. As a result, many patients are opting to use private clinics for their examinations. Sadly, some clinics claim to be able to give a diagnosis without any evidence. This has been highlighted by the BBC's Panorama programme, which exposed a number of private clinics claiming to diagnose ADHD without a proper assessment.
To be diagnosed with ADHD an individual must meet at least six of the criteria, including inattention and hyperactivity. The symptoms must have occurred at different times in their lives. The diagnostic process includes an interview and background assessment. Psychiatry UK, one of the leading providers in England of private ADHD assessments, encourages people to think carefully about their options before opting for an assessment online. During the clinical interview you can share your experiences living with ADHD and discuss how your symptoms are affecting your daily life. The psychiatrist will explain the results of the tests and provide you with a diagnosis. They will also offer advice on the dangers and benefits of medication, and suggest a plan of treatment. The first line of treatment is medication, however there are also non-medical options.
ADHD is one of the neurodevelopmental disorders defined in the DSM5 manual of mental health diagnoses. It's a behavioural condition that is characterised by inattentiveness and hyperactivity/impulsivity. These symptoms are not typical for your age group and must occur in a variety of settings (e.g. at school and at home). They should also last for more than six months and impact your academic, social and professional performance.
You could be assessed for ADHD by a psychologist if you are in school. Their report can be used to justify your claim for reasonable accommodations and Disabled Student's Allowance. This is especially useful for students with ADHD and need to access additional assistance at the university.

If you are diagnosed with ADHD as an adult, it's essential to receive a thorough diagnosis and discuss treatment options. The assessment should be conducted by a psychiatrist or a specialist nurse in mental health. They are the only healthcare professionals in the UK who are able to diagnose ADHD. The test usually involves a 45-90 minute discussion with a psychiatrist. It should include your mental health, family history and other factors which can affect ADHD symptoms.
The psychiatrist will also try to rule out any other medical conditions that could be mistaken for ADHD like anxiety, depression, or thyroid problems. They will also look at your family history and school reports. The process could take a while however, it's worth the long wait.
